Portugal - Fossil Energy Stock Change
In 2019, the country was number 17 comparing other countries in Fossil Energy Stock Change at -624.3 Gigawatthours. Portugal is overtaken by Croatia, which was ranked number 16 at -385.55 Gigawatthours and is followed by Macedonia at -829.47 Gigawatthours. Norway ranked the highest with 9,353.72 Gigawatthours in 2019, -249.7% versus 2018. Finland, Ireland and Ukraine resp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Italy recorded the best 5 years average growth at +231.4% per year, while Kosovo recorded the worst performance at -100% per year.
